Roads and buildings Tunjungan Siola
One of the famous buildings on the street is the House Siola Tunjungan. Before becoming Siola Stores, this building was used as a British department store named "WHITEAWAY". In the year 1940 is used to sell imported goods from Japan, its name changed to "TOKO CHIYODA". Although amended several times instead of the front face, now Siola Building is still a land marker for the environment around the road Tunjungan.

Goederenemplacement Sidotopo

Source: en Staatsspoor Tramwegen in Nederlandsch Indie 1875 - 1925
The steam locomotive that ever existed in the dipo Sidotopo macam2 model. For the width of the rail was the dominant type in 1067 until now, type 1435 used in the initial line-Gundih semarang NIS-Kedung Teak and so forth, type 750/600 in Aceh and several branch lines (now inactive / except for sugar cane lorries).
